- 10. Muscle endurance: The ability of a muscle or group of muscles to sustain repeated contractions or maintain a level of force over an extended period.
- 11. Muscle strength: The maximum amount of force that a muscle or group of muscles can generate.
- 12. Cardiovascular endurance: The ability of the heart, blood vessels, and lungs to supply oxygen and nutrients to the muscles during sustained physical activity.
- 13. Coordination: The ability to integrate and harmonize different body parts and movements effectively to achieve a specific action or task.

- 14. Curl-ups: A physical exercise that involves flexing the abdominal muscles by lifting the upper body from a lying position to a sitting position.
- 15. Push-ups: A physical exercise that involves lowering and raising the body by straightening and bending the arms while in a prone position, primarily working the chest, shoulders, and triceps.
- 16. Sit and reach test: A fitness assessment that measures the flexibility of the lower back and hamstrings by sitting on the floor, reaching forward, and measuring the distance reached.
- 17. Shuttle run: A fitness test or exercise that involves running back and forth between two points, testing agility, speed, and coordination.
